Google Analytics 4 does not accept custom event names that include spaces. Segment replaces spaces in the Event Name in the Custom Event action with an underscore. As a result, you will see custom events snake cased in Google Analytics 4.

Google Analytics 4 is also case sensitive. If you would like all event names to be lowercase, use the `Lowercase Event Name` setting in the Custom Event action. If this setting is disabled, Google will treat event names with different casing as distinct events. With Google Analytics 4, you must create custom dimensions and metrics within the Google Analytics 4 interface and link event parameters to the corresponding dimension or metric. When creating the dimension or metric, you can either select a parameter from the list of already collected fields or enter the name of the parameter you plan to collect in the future.
